Eligibility Criteria for Ph.D. in Pharmacy at Manav Bharti University
- Master’s degree (M.Pharm, M.Sc. Pharmacy, or equivalent) with a minimum of 55% marks (or 5.0 CGPA on a 10‑point scale) from a recognized university.
- Valid GATE/GPAT score is preferred but not mandatory.
- Candidates must have a solid foundation in pharmaceutical sciences, demonstrated through research publications or project work.
- For candidates holding a B.Pharm, an additional 2 years of relevant work experience or a research stint is required.
Entrance Exam for Ph.D. in Pharmacy at Manav Bharti University
The university conducts its own entrance examination, known as the MBU PhD Pharmacy Test. The exam evaluates:
- Core concepts of pharmaceutical chemistry, pharmacology, pharmaceutics, and pharmacognosy.
- Research methodology and statistical analysis.
- Analytical reasoning and problem‑solving abilities.
Applicants with a qualifying GATE/GPAT score may be exempted from the written test and proceed directly to the interview stage.
Fee Structure for Ph.D. in Pharmacy at Manav Bharti University
| Component | Annual Fee (INR) |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Tuition & Laboratory Charges | 85,000 | Includes access to all labs and e‑resources. |
| Research Project Funding | 30,000 | Allocated for consumables and field work. |
| Library & Digital Resources | 12,000 | Unlimited online journal access. |
| Examination & Evaluation Fee | 8,000 | Per semester. |
| Total Approx. Annual Cost | 1,35,000 |
Scholarships, research grants, and teaching assistantships can significantly reduce the out‑of‑pocket expense.
Admission Process for Ph.D. in Pharmacy at Manav Bharti University
- Online Application: Fill the web‑based form and upload scanned copies of academic transcripts and identification proof.
- Entrance Examination: Appear for the MBU PhD Pharmacy Test or submit a valid GATE/GPAT score.
- Interview & Proposal Review: Shortlisted candidates present a research proposal and undergo a panel interview.
- Final Admission Offer: Upon successful evaluation, the university issues an admission letter with fee payment details.
- Enrollment: Pay the first installment, submit the signed agreement, and commence coursework.

Manav Bharti University Ph.D. Syllabus for Pharmacy
The doctoral curriculum blends rigorous coursework with extensive research. Core modules include:
- Advanced Pharmaceutical Chemistry
- Research Methodology & Biostatistics
- Clinical Trial Design and Ethics
- Pharmaceutics – Novel Drug Delivery
- Regulatory Affairs & Intellectual Property
Elective courses are tailored to the chosen specialization, allowing candidates to acquire niche expertise.

- 1. What is the typical duration of the Ph.D. program?
- Usually 3‑4 years, depending on the research progress and publication requirements.
- 2. Can I pursue the Ph.D. part‑time while working?
- Yes, the university provides a flexible part‑time schedule for working professionals, though it may extend the overall duration.
- 3. Is there any provision for collaborative research with other institutions?
- Manav Bharti University has MoUs with several national and international institutes, facilitating joint projects and exchange programs.
- 4. How many publications are required for thesis submission?
- At least two articles in peer‑reviewed journals (indexed in Scopus/Web of Science) are mandatory.
